You will study processes of upheaval and change within religious traditions and some of the complex – and sometimes clashing – local, regional and national perspectives on familiar and unfamiliar controversies. Using a mix of historical, sociological and ethnographic sources, approaches and methods, this module will help you to develop your understanding of the nature and role of ‘religion’ in historical and contemporary societies. You will make significant use of the rich resources available online via the OU Library.
With the Why is Religion Controversial module at The Open University you will learn:
– ways to analyse the complex, subtle and sometimes controversial ways in which religious ideas and practices are embedded in society and culture
– some of the ways in which religious ideas and practices reproduce and destabilise societal and cultural norms
– the range of levels – individual, community, national and global – at which religious ideas and practices are significant
– how to analyse the extent to which translation and communication of religious ideas can cause misunderstanding, tension, conflict and controversy
– how to think clearly and in an informed way about a subject acknowledged to be of growing importance in today’s world.
